About
SEO與程式設計語言對網站可讀性與索引的影響
在當今數位行銷的競爭環境中,網站的可讀性與索引效率對於SEO至關重要。程式設計語言的選擇與應用,將直接影響搜尋引擎的爬取能力與網站排名。無論是網路行銷公司或是SEO公司,在規劃SEO策略時,都應考慮程式語言與SEO的關聯性,以確保網站在Google Search Console與Google Analytics中的表現優異,進而提升搜尋可見度。
影響網站可讀性與索引的程式設計語言
1. HTML與網站架構對SEO的影響
HTML(超文本標記語言)是網站的基礎,對於on page SEO的優化具有決定性影響。搜尋引擎爬蟲主要依靠HTML結構來理解網站內容,因此網站應遵循以下幾個HTML最佳實踐:
- 語意化HTML標籤:使用
<header>
、<article>
、<section>
等語意標籤,讓搜尋引擎更容易理解內容架構,提高Google Search Console中的可讀性評分。 - 正確使用標題標籤(H1-H6):標題標籤有助於內容層級的清晰度,有助於數位行銷策略中的關鍵字排名。
- meta標籤優化:良好的
<title>
和<meta description>
不僅提高點擊率,也影響搜尋排名。
2. JavaScript對SEO的挑戰與機會
許多網路行銷專家在進行網站開發時,會使用JavaScript來增強用戶體驗(UX),但過度依賴JavaScript可能會影響SEO表現:
- Google爬蟲需要額外時間解析JavaScript,若內容僅靠JavaScript渲染,可能導致部分內容無法被索引。
- 解決方案:
- 採用伺服器端渲染(SSR),例如使用Next.js或Nuxt.js,確保搜尋引擎能夠讀取完整的HTML。
- 使用Google Search Console的「URL 檢查」工具測試JavaScript內容是否可見。
3. CSS對SEO的影響
CSS主要負責網站的外觀設計,但過度複雜的CSS可能影響網站載入速度,進而影響SEO排名:
- 建議:
- 壓縮CSS文件,減少不必要的樣式代碼。
- 避免大量的內嵌CSS,應將CSS外部化以減少HTML代碼體積。
- 使用Google Analytics分析使用者行為,評估CSS對網站可讀性的影響。
SEO友善的程式設計實踐
1. 優化網站載入速度
網站速度是Google排名的重要因素之一,可透過以下方法提升:
- 使用CDN(內容傳遞網路),加快靜態資源的載入。
- 壓縮圖片與資源,使用WebP格式減少檔案大小。
- 利用瀏覽器快取,提升返回訪客的瀏覽速度。
- 定期使用Google PageSpeed Insights檢測網站載入速度,並在Google Search Console內檢查頁面體驗報告。
2. 確保網站對行動裝置友善(Mobile-Friendly)
行動端搜尋量已超越桌機,Google採用「行動優先索引」(Mobile-First Indexing),這對於local SEO與Google商家檔案的排名影響極大:
- 採用響應式設計(Responsive Web Design),確保不同設備上顯示正常。
- 避免使用Flash或舊版插件,這些技術已不受現代瀏覽器支持,影響搜尋可讀性。
- 在Google Search Console中檢查行動相容性報告,確保網站適應各種設備。
3. 強化結構化數據(Schema Markup)
結構化數據可幫助搜尋引擎理解網站內容,提高在搜尋結果中的點擊率(CTR):
- 使用JSON-LD標記Schema數據,例如產品、評論、FAQ等,這對於local SEO尤其重要。
- 在Google Search Console的「結構化數據測試工具」中驗證標記是否正確。
SEO與程式語言的整合對企業的影響
對於企業而言,選擇適合的程式語言與SEO策略,能夠影響品牌的數位曝光度與市場競爭力:
- 網路行銷公司與SEO公司應確保網站符合最佳SEO技術標準,提升用戶體驗與搜尋引擎友善度。
- 數位行銷策略應該考量技術SEO,確保網站架構可讀性與索引效率,讓搜尋引擎更容易理解網站內容。
- 結合Google Analytics分析網站流量,根據數據調整技術與內容策略,提升轉換率。
結論
程式設計語言不僅影響網站的功能,也決定了SEO表現。無論是HTML、JavaScript還是CSS,都應以搜尋引擎友善的方式實施,以確保網站的可讀性與索引效率。透過適當的技術優化,如語意化HTML、JavaScript渲染最佳化、行動端適配與結構化數據應用,可以提高網站在Google搜尋結果中的排名,為企業帶來更高的流量與轉換率。對於希望在數位市場中取得優勢的企業,SEO與程式設計的融合已成為不可忽視的重要策略。